Best 74337 Oklahoma Public Preschools (2025-26)

For the 2025-26 school year, there are 2 public preschools serving 216 students in 74337, OK.
The top ranked public preschool in 74337, OK is Mazie Elementary School. Overall testing rank is based on a school's combined math and reading proficiency test score ranking.
Public preschools in zipcode 74337 have an average math proficiency score of 35% (versus the Oklahoma public pre school average of 29%), and reading proficiency score of 25% (versus the 27% statewide average). Pre schools in 74337, OK have an average ranking of 6/10, which is in the top 50% of Oklahoma public pre schools.
Minority enrollment is 37% of the student body (majority American Indian), which is less than the Oklahoma public preschool average of 56% (majority Hispanic and American Indian).
